![]() ![]() The BT TV Box Pro has all the features we'd expect from a modern TV box, but it also manages to do some things differently too. What features does the BT TV Box Pro offer? Overall, the TV Box Pro is sleeker and more stylish than any BT TV box we've seen before, plus it's the most advanced when it comes to features and capabilities. The BT TV Box Pro also comes with a Bluetooth remote that doesn't rely on a direct line of sight, plus there are various eco settings on the box itself including a standby mode that puts the box into deep hibernation in the hours when it is unlikely to be used rather than waste energy on the standard standby mode. ![]() The main specifications for the BT TV Box Pro are: While the BT TV Box Pro is still based on the YouView interface, the box itself has received quite a few feature upgrades - we look at those more closely below. Since the box is only provided to BT TV customers and cannot be bought separately, customers who like the look of the TV Box Pro will need to sign up to both BT TV and BT broadband. It is now the standard TV box provided to BT TV customers, so all customers signing up to new deals will receive it instead of the old BT YouView box. ![]() The BT TV Box Pro was first launched in mid-2021 as a refreshed rival to Sky Q and Virgin TV 360. Regular TV watching is still handled via the satellite dish, and you can see a full list of the features available with and without an internet connection on the Sky website. There’s no mention of 4K on that particular thread, but Amazon Prime recommends 15Mbps, while Netflix says 25Mbps – so probably somewhere around that ballpark.Īs with all these things, the faster your broadband, the better your experience – though it’s worth remembering this is just for the streaming side of things. According to Sky’s own terms, you’ll need at least 3Mbps for standard definition streaming, and 8Mbps for HD. ![]() Sky Q is compatible with any broadband provider, although there are certain speed requirements for the ‘On Demand’ streaming services to function in an acceptable manner.
